Which foreign policy problem did the United States face as a result of the Persian Gulf War?
Deffense [45]

The foreign policy problem that the U.S. faced with the Gulf War was B. resentment of the presence of U.S. troops in the Middle East.

<h3>What happened after the Persian Gulf War?</h3>

In order to wage the war, the U.S. had stationed soldiers in Saudi Arabia which several holy sites in Islam.

When the war was over, many Muslims demanded that the U.S. leave the nation and were angry about U.S. troops being in the Middle East.
